BEHIND THE BRAND:
LASCAUX
THE SPIRIT OF COLOURS
THE SPIRIT OF COLOURS® Lascaux was founded in Switzerland by Alois K. Diethelm in 1963. He had been an apprentice paintmaker since the 1930s and became fascinated with the art materials he was working with.
His contact with artists and designers during this formative period led him in the late 1950s to begin to develop a water-based paint that offered the qualities of traditional oil and tempera paints. This resulted in Europe’s first artists’ quality acrylic paint and it was with this breakthrough that the company Lascaux was born.
Since then, Lascaux have gone on to forge a reputation for innovation, expertise, and exceptional quality across their range of water-based paints that include gouache, watercolour, and state-of-the-art printmaking products. This has led Lascaux paints and mediums to be internationally recognised for their purity, colour depth, and durability. Trusted by professional art restorers, designers and artists, Lascaux colours are used for significant interior and exterior art and design projects. This includes two large murals for the Sony Building, New York by Dorothea Rockburne and the painted pillars of Tay Road Bridge, Dundee by local artists Fraser Gray and Martin McGuiness. Other notable artists who have put their faith in Lascaux products include Bridget Riley, Sol LeWitt, and Michael Craig Martin.
Alois’s daughter Barbara Diethelm, a practising painter, took over the business in the 1990s and continues to uphold Lascaux’s integral philosophy of premium quality and pioneering craftsmanship. She has introduced innovative products including the multisensory Resonance Gouache collection and the visionary five-colour Sirius Primary System. In 2004 she set up the charitable foundation Fondation Lascaux with her husband, the painter Werner Schmidt. The foundation explores a spiritual approach to art, life, and the cosmos with an ethos of restoring the balance between mankind and nature by promoting the importance of colours for a new consciousness.

THE LASCAUX RANGE
ARTIST ACRYLIC
Highly concentrated with a buttery texture, Lascaux Artist Acrylic is luminous and intense offering superb colour depth. The range is lightfast, weather-resistant, and durable, making it ideal for outdoor projects as well as traditional studio painting.
ACRYLIC GOUACHE
A unique acrylic-modified tempera paint, Lascaux Gouache is highly concentrated and can be heavily diluted. The range is characterised by its purity, brilliance, depth of colour and lightfastness, with a beautiful satin-matt finish.
SIRIUS FLUID WATERCOLOUR PAINT
The Sirius Primary System exclusively developed by Lascaux comprises five primary colours alongside black and white from which it is possible to mix over 78,000 pure and harmonious hues. These watercolours are pure, luminous, and vibrant.
